SALSA RICE WITH BLACK BEANS AND CORN



Salsa Rice with Black Beans and Corn image

Provided by Robin Miller : Food Network

Categories     side-dish

Time 25m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 cup rice, regular or instant
1/2 (14-ounce) can black beans, drained
1/2 cup prepared salsa
1/2 cup frozen corn, thawed
2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ro leaves
Salt and fre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• In a medium sauce pot, cook rice according to package instructions. When the rice is half way cooked, add black beans, salsa, and cook about 10 minutes for regular rice and 3 minutes for instant rice .Continue cooking rice. Remove the pot, using a spoon, stir in chopped cilantro and season, to taste, with salt and black pepper.

SALSA RICE DINNER



Salsa Rice Dinner image

This one has been in my recipe files for quite a long time. We have made it with leftover pork chops, leftover pork tenderloin and also chicken. We really prefer the chicken over the pork. It's super easy, really tasty and it makes a lot. We usually serve it with a little side salad and a few tortilla chips and a bit of...

Provided by Maggie M

Categories     Casseroles

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 c cooked shredded skinless chicken breast
1 c shredded monterey jack cheese
1 c shredded cheddar cheese
1 can(s) cream of celery soup - healthy request
1 soup can of water
1 c salsa - store bought or home made - heat of your choice
1/2 c finely chopped onion
1 can(s) (4 oz) diced green chilies - heat of your choice
1-1/2 c cooked white rice
sour cream for garnish
sliced black olives for garnish
snipped chives for garnish

Steps:

  • 1. If you have leftover chicken feel free to shred and use it. If not .. drop a chicken breast into a pot of boiling water .. turn off the heat and let is steep for 35 minutes. Remove the breast from the water and shred with forks or your fingers.
  • 2. Preheat oven to 375. Lightly spray an 8x8 baking dish and set aside.
  • 3. Combine the 2 cheeses in a small bowl and set aside.
  • 4. Combine the soup, water and the salsa and mix well. Add the onions and diced green chilies and stir to combine then set aside.
  • 5. Place the cooked rice into the bottom of the baking dish. Top with the shredded chicken. Sprinkle about half of the cheese over the chicken then pour the soup and salsa mixture over top of all.
  • 6. Top with the remaining cheese the cover with foil. Bake for 30 minutes, then remove the foil and bake for another 10 - 15 minutes or until bubbly and the cheese is completely melted.
  • 7. Allow it to sit for about 5 minutes before serving. Serve hot garnished with a dollop of sour cream, a few black olive slices and a sprinkling of chives.

BEST SPANISH RICE



Best Spanish Rice image

The combination of picante sauce and chicken broth makes this easy recipe very tasty!

Provided by Angela Sims

Categories     Side Dish     Rice Side Dish Recipes     Spanish Rice Recipes

Time 30m

Yield 5

Number Of Ingredients 5

2 tablespoons oil
2 tablespoons chopped onion
1 ½ cups uncooked white rice
2 cups chicken broth
1 cup chunky salsa

Steps:

  • Heat oil in a large, heavy skillet over medium heat. Stir in onion, and cook until tender, about 5 minutes.
  • Mix rice into skillet, stirring often. When rice begins to brown, stir in chicken broth and salsa. Reduce heat, cover and simmer 20 minutes, until liquid has been absorbed.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 286 calories, Carbohydrate 50.9 g, Cholesterol 2 mg, Fat 6.2 g, Fiber 1.6 g, Protein 5.7 g, SaturatedFat 1 g, Sodium 696.6 mg, Sugar 2.3 g

EASY SALSA RICE



Easy Salsa Rice image

Feel free to saute a little green bell pepper with onions, you may adjust the garlic and chili flakes to taste --- this is very good! :)

Provided by Kittencalrecipezazz

Categories     Rice

Time 25m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 tablespoons oil
1/4 cup finely chopped onion
1 tablespoon fresh finely chopped garlic
1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(adjust to heat level) (optional)
1 cup uncooked white rice (I use converted white rice)
2 cups water or 2 cups low sodium chicken broth
1 (16 ounce) jar Pace Picante Sauce
1/4-1/2 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per (to taste) (optional)
salt (optional and to taste)

Steps:

  • In a medium saucepan heat oil over medium heat; add in onion, garlic and chili flakes, cook stirring for 3 minutes.
  • Add in rice, water and salsa; stir and bring to a boil.
  • Reduce heat to low, cover and simmer for about 20-22 minutes or until the rice is tender or is at desired doneness.
  • Season with salt and black pepper if desired.

Tips:

  • Use fresh ingredients: The fresher the ingredients, the better your salsa rice dinner will taste. If possible, use tomatoes, onions, and cilantro that are in season.
  • Don't be afraid to experiment: There are many different ways to make salsa. Feel free to add your own favorite ingredients or adjust the proportions of the ingredients in the recipe to suit your taste.
  • Make sure the rice is cooked perfectly: The rice is an important part of this dish, so make sure it is cooked according to the package directions. If the rice is undercooked, it will be hard and chewy. If the rice is overcooked, it will be mushy.
  • Serve the salsa rice dinner with your favorite toppings: Some popular toppings include shredded cheese, sour cream, guacamole, and black beans.
